A defense attorney is your representative against the power of the state. Their role is to protect your constitutional rights, challenge the evidence presented against you, and advocate for the best possible outcome. Whether you are facing misdemeanor or felony charges, a defense attorney ensures you don't face the system alone. They handle all communications with prosecutors and guide you through every stage of the legal process, from the initial investigation through to a potential trial or plea agreement.
A criminal lawyer can represent either the prosecution or the defense. A defense lawyer specifically focuses on representing individuals accused of crimes. In Tempe, you'll want a dedicated defense attorney to protect your rights against the state's charges. They're focused solely on your case.
You should hire a criminal lawyer as soon as possible after an arrest or if you believe you are under investigation. The sooner you have legal representation in Tempe, the better your chances of a favorable outcome. Early intervention can impact the evidence and potential charges.
Cases with strong, irrefutable evidence, like clear video footage or multiple eyewitnesses, are often the hardest to defend. However, a skilled defense attorney in Tempe can still find weaknesses in the prosecution's case. Every case has unique factors to explore.

Cases involving serious felonies with substantial evidence are typically the most challenging. This could include cases with DNA evidence or confessions. Even in these tough situations, a Tempe defense attorney can work to challenge evidence or negotiate plea deals.
A lawyer is a broad term for someone licensed to practice law. A criminal lawyer specializes in criminal law, dealing with crimes and their penalties. If you're facing criminal charges in Tempe, you need the specialized knowledge of a criminal defense lawyer.
